If not covid then what? Or should I book another test?

9 replies

hippospot · 29/01/2021 08:46

So today is day 4 of symptoms.

Day 1 - nausea, terrible headache, achy shoulders and chest, feeling hotter than usual but thermometer said it wasn't a fever.

Day 2 - same plus short of breath

Day 3 - headache eased a bit, shoulders no longer achy, but chest feels tight and short of breath

Day 4 - chest sore and short of breath

No cough, no fever, but the shortness of breath has got me really worried.

I did a covid test on day 2 and it came back negative on day 3. But how reliable are they? Is a false negative possible?

Iamsodonewith2020 · 29/01/2021 09:09

Tested 3 times before my positive result showed. Like you I just felt awful and knew I had it. Headache on the Friday and felt awful , contacted by T&T on Sunday as colleagues had tested positive so I tested. Negative on Sunday, tested again on Tuesday as now had difficulty breathing and severe lethargy, test inconclusive so tested again on the Thursday and it was positive. Had been unwell for nearly a week when I tested positive and only got one of the 3 covid symptoms on day 9!!!
